NRCA PUTS KEY CONSTRUCTION DETAILS ON BUILDSITE


Rosemont, Ill.—The National Roofing Contractors Association (NRCA) has partnered with BuildSite to make its most important construction details available to BuildSite's audience of construction contractors and their suppliers.

BuildSite will now include popular roof system construction details found in The NRCA Roofing Manual: Membrane Roof Systems, as well as frequently accessed waterproofing details found in The NRCA Waterproofing Manual, 2005 Edition. BuildSite will present the individual details as "category documents"—users will see them in the context of searches for products in BuildSite’s waterproofing and roofing categories, including Sheet Waterproofing, Bentonite Waterproofing, Metal Roofing, Built-Up, Membrane and Coated Foamed categories.

"Designers and contractors have long considered NRCA as the definitive source for roofing and waterproofing details," comments Ned Trainor, president of BuildSite. "Our customers will be delighted to easily access them for submittals and job-site reference."

NRCA Executive Vice President Bill Good says: "NRCA is delighted BuildSite has chosen to incorporate NRCA's most frequently used details in its products. Our goal, of course, is to see the details widely used in the industry, and BuildSite's initiative supports that goal."

Established in 1886, NRCA is one of the construction industry's oldest trade associations and the voice of professional roofing contractors worldwide. It is an association of roofing, roof deck, and waterproofing contractors; industry-related associate members, including manufacturers, distributors, architects, consultants, engineers, and city, state, and government agencies; and international members. NRCA has more than 4,600 members from all 50 states and 54 countries and is affiliated with 105 local, state, regional and international roofing contractor associations.

BuildSite, through www.buildsite.com, provides a single source of product, technical and procurement information for commercial, residential and infrastructure construction along with software tools for messaging and construction submittals. The company focuses on the information needs of contractors and their suppliers. It also reaches a broader audience of professionals, including architects, consultants, engineers and facility managers. The BuildSite database consists of more than 18,000 products from more than 250 manufacturers.
